Environmental friendliness of the ski resort Hochoetz – Oetz

All restricted forest areas are fenced off and marked with signs. Waste is separated in the ski resort. In summer, the ski slopes are used for grazing and are fertilised with pure manure. An energy management system is used for snow production. There is a photovoltaic system at the WIDIVERSUM. Waste air from the engine room of the Acherkogelbahn lift is used for heating and hot water in the Panoramarestaurant on the mountain. Ski buses are promoted comprehensively. Events are planned sustainably.


Public transportation/on-site mobility

  • No direct train connection
    The nearest train station is in the Ötztal-Bahnhof district at the start of the Ötztal Valley, around 7 kilometres from the ski resort. Buses run from there.
  • Ski buses
  • Scheduled buses
  • Ski buses run from Oetz, Habichen, Piburg and Sautens directly to the base station in Oetz. The newly constructed ski bus stop is situated right next to the gondola lift. A ski bus runs from Haiming and Haimingerberg to Ochsengarten. There are also ski buses between Ochsengarten and Kühtai, as well as other ski buses and scheduled buses that can be used free of charge throughout the Ötztal Valley with a valid ski pass.
